The 50th Anniversary Screening program is a celebration of feature films that have been made by AFTRS alumni. In the last 50 years, the school has produced many talented filmmakers that have been at the forefront of cinema culture, producing work that has moved, challenged and thrilled audiences around the world.
Each film in this series was directed by an AFTRS Alumni, and almost all of them feature alumni in key creative roles including producers, cinematographers, editors, and production and costume designers.
In partnership with the National Film and Sound Archive (NFSA), the films in this free program will be presented entirely on 35mm prints borrowed from their collection, treating audiences to a rich and unique cinematic experience.
